Bone Tomahawk (2015): A Brutal Fusion of Western and Horror

S. Craig Zahler’s Bone Tomahawk stands as one of the most daring genre hybrids of the last decade, blending the dusty grit of the American Western with the savage intensity of horror. Anchored by a commanding performance from Kurt Russell as Sheriff Franklin Hunt, the film follows a small-town posse on a perilous rescue mission after a group of townsfolk are abducted by a mysterious tribe of cannibalistic cave dwellers.

Balancing slow-burn tension with moments of shocking violence, Zahler’s directorial debut won praise for its sharp dialogue, atmospheric world-building, and unflinching brutality. With standout turns from Patrick Wilson, Matthew Fox, and Richard Jenkins, Bone Tomahawk carves out a unique place in modern cinema—a frontier tale as harrowing as it is unforgettable.
